Analysis Cubes Configuration Overview

Vision Analysis Cubes is part of the Vision Performance Management module.

Analysis Cubes provides you with a Vision project data cube and a general ledger data cube from which you can create custom Vision reports with Microsoft Excel® or any business intelligence tool that supports SQL Server Analysis Services OLAP cubes. It also serves as the data sources for the performance dashboards that you create.

The Analysis Cubes configuration in Vision Configuration > General > Analysis Cubes is only part of the overall Analysis Cubes configuration. When you configure Analysis Cubes for the first time or upgrade to a new version, you must follow the Analysis Cubes configuration instructions in the Deltek Vision Installation and Configuration Guide for Performance Management (Analysis Cubes). You can download the PDF guide from the Deltek Customer Care Connect site. This guide provides you with complete configuration instructions and the correct order in which you must perform the various configuration steps.

You complete the following Analysis Cubes configuration in Vision Configuration > General > Analysis Cubes:

  • Select which measures and dimensions populate the data cubes.
  • Create key performance indicators (KPIs) for the data cubes.
  • Create calculated measures for the data cubes.
  • Set up currency exchange information for the data cubes (used for presentation currencies).

You can access Analysis Cubes Configuration in Vision only if you purchased and activated the Performance Management application. If you have not purchased Performance Management, you still have access to Analysis Cubes, but you do not have access to Analysis Cubes Configuration and the additional capabilities that it provides, or to the dimensions and measures that were added in Vision 7.0 and later releases. You have access to only the dimensions and measures available in prior releases.

Important Information

  • After you make the initial Analysis Cubes configuration selections in Vision Configuration, and anytime that you modify these settings, a system administrator must use the Vision Resource Kit to update the changes in the data cubes.
  • If you remove dimensions and measures from the data cubes after they have populated the data cubes and you have reports that include these removed fields, the fields are automatically removed from custom reports after you refresh report data. You must rebuild the reports.
  • If you activate the Performance Management edition of Vision Performance Management, the sample performance dashboards require that the Analysis Cubes include a specific set of dimensions, measures, and KPIs. If one of those required data items has been removed from the Analysis Cubes, you may receive errors when you try to publish or display the sample dashboards or your custom dashboards that are based on those sample dashboards.

    If you receive an error when you publish or display a dashboard, and the message indicates that required data is missing from the Analysis Cubes, click Restore Required Configuration on the toolbar on the Analysis Cubes form (Configuration > General > Analysis Cubes) to restore all of the dimensions, measures, and KPIs that the performance dashboards need. You must also reprocess the Analysis Cubes to apply the updated configuration.

User-Defined Fields that You Want to Populate the Vision Data Cubes

You select user-defined fields to populate the Vision data cubes in Configuration > General > User Defined Components. This applies only if you purchased the Performance Management module.
